Output 59a21d717b140e21083d65f01515dbd4d44e44481f532b557a0805c610a57a49:2

value
17109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48fdf64560c29c4160b35a3a62060c325df8b30a OP_EQUAL
address
38LxowjA3fAAJ4VHtwK76PuuUGCbYp1UtC
transaction
59a21d717b140e21083d65f01515dbd4d44e44481f532b557a0805c610a57a49
spent
true